Why Playdough is a Kid-Friendly Superstar
Playdough is more than just a simple toy - it's an instrument that allows kids to express themselves freely. By manipulating colorful, tactile dough, children develop their fine motor skills, hand-eye coordination, and creativity. It's the perfect way to encourage imaginative play, problem-solving, and critical thinking.
